Being Lonely and being alone.
Khoorshid khanoom�s posts was very interesting. She talked about 3 subjects that I used to think about them a lot.
One of them which was about loneliness was an answer to my questions.
People usually think by getting married they can overcome their loneliness and can find some one to share their moments and make memories. But just after few months or few years, they will find out nothing have been changed, their partner is not the one who always understand them and welcome them and there is no living happily ever after.
Thus they will get board of their partners and will return to their lonely shell and become invisible again.
Later on according to their possibilities they will choose to accept their lonely life or have an affair or get marry with some one else or become homosexual, just to find some one who can always love and understand them.
And again after a few month or few years they will find out things are the same, no one can understand their true feeling...
And then they will start believing that there is no real love exists: Marriage will destroys love and even Rome and Juliet love each other cuz they didn�t live together�
The point is we want to take advantage of love to cover up our loneliness. But being lonely is not some thing that we can cover it by some one else�s help. It�s internal. We should learn how to teat ourselves, so we won�t feel unloved and lonely when we are by ourselves.
This is not true that there is no real love exists, and there is no one trust worthy to love. Its just love has different stages and sexual love (the love between 2 different sexes, or same sexes for homosexual people) is just one of the basic loves that we can experiences.
We can open our eyes to different sort of loves.
When we have some thing to love we are not lonely again.
